Monterey County Tourism Revenue Hits $3.3 Billion Record
Monterey County's tourism revenue hit $3.3 billion in 2026, reflecting a full economic recovery. This milestone marks a new growth phase for the local tourism industry.

South Korea Sees 53% Sales Growth from Asian Tourists in Golden Week 2026
South Korea welcomed roughly 220,000 visitors from Japan and China during Golden Week 2026, leading to a 53% rise in sales. The growth demonstrates the impact of this peak travel period on the country's tourism sector.
